| Chicago Cubs (18-12, first in the NL Central) 
				vs. Pittsburgh Pirates (11-19, fifth in the NL Central)
 Pittsburgh; Wednesday, 6:40 p.m. EDT
 
 PITCHING PROBABLES: Cubs: Matthew Boyd (2-2, 2.54 ERA, 1.38 
				WHIP, 24 strikeouts); Pirates: Carmen Mlodzinski (1-3, 6.95 ERA, 
				1.82 WHIP, 18 strikeouts)
 
 BETMGM SPORTSBOOK LINE: Cubs -171, Pirates +143; over/under is 9 
				runs
 
 BOTTOM LINE: The Pittsburgh Pirates look to stop their four-game 
				home skid with a win over the Chicago Cubs.
 
 Pittsburgh is 6-8 in home games and 11-19 overall. The Pirates 
				are 8-5 in games when they did not give up a home run.
 
 Chicago has an 18-12 record overall and a 9-5 record in road 
				games. The Cubs have a 13-2 record in games when they scored 
				five or more runs.
 
 The matchup Wednesday is the second time these teams meet this 
				season.
 
 TOP PERFORMERS: Oneil Cruz leads the Pirates with eight home 
				runs while slugging .531. Isiah Kiner-Falefa is 12-for-37 with 
				two doubles and two RBI over the last 10 games.
 
 Seiya Suzuki leads the Cubs with a .298 batting average, and has 
				six doubles, two triples, seven home runs, 12 walks and 25 RBI. 
				Ian Happ is 15-for-42 with a home run and six RBI over the last 
				10 games.
 
 LAST 10 GAMES: Pirates: 3-7, .274 batting average, 4.81 ERA, 
				outscored by 16 runs
 
 Cubs: 6-4, .275 batting average, 4.06 ERA, outscored opponents 
				by 10 runs
